Adult Children of Emotionally Immature Parents: Insights from the Audiobook

Part 1 Adult Children of Emotionally Immature Parents by Lindsay C. Gibson Summary

"Adult Children of Emotionally Immature Parents" by Lindsay C. Gibson explores the impact of having emotionally immature parents on their children's development and emotional well-being. The book delves into how these parents struggle with emotional regulation, lack empathy, and often prioritize their own needs over those of their children, resulting in a dysfunctional family dynamic.

 Key Concepts:

  1. Emotional Immaturity: The book defines emotional immaturity as a lack of emotional awareness, poor coping mechanisms, and difficulty with interpersonal relationships. This can manifest in various ways, such as reprimanding children for expressing feelings, dismissing their needs, or being overly focused on their own emotions.
  2. Types of Emotionally Immature Parents: Gibson categorizes emotionally immature parents into four main types:

- The Emotional Parent: Overly emotional and unstable, likely to shift their mood based on their feelings.

- The Driven Parent: Focused on success and achievement, often neglecting emotional connection.

- The Passive Parent: Avoidant and disengaged, showing little involvement in their children's lives.

- The Rejecting Parent: Dismissive and critical, often making children feel unwanted or unloved.

  1. Impact on Children: Gibson discusses how children raised by these types of parents may struggle with self-esteem, form healthy relationships, and express emotions. They often take on the role of caretaker, suppress their own needs, or develop maladaptive coping mechanisms.
  2. Healing and Growth: The book offers strategies for adult children to understand their experiences and work towards healing. It emphasizes the importance of self-compassion, setting boundaries, and seeking supportive relationships. Gibson encourages readers to acknowledge their feelings and break the cycle of emotional immaturity.
  3. Therapeutic Insight: The author also highlights the value of therapy as a means to navigate the challenges posed by emotionally immature parenting, emphasizing that understanding one's past and working through unresolved feelings can lead to personal growth.

Overall, "Adult Children of Emotionally Immature Parents" serves as a guide for individuals seeking to understand their familial challenges and offers tools for overcoming the emotional fallout of such relationships.

Part 2 Adult Children of Emotionally Immature Parents Author

Lindsay C. Gibson is a clinical psychologist known for her work focusing on emotional development and relationships. She is the author of the book Adult Children of Emotionally Immature Parents, which was first published in 2015. This book addresses the impact of having emotionally immature parents on their adult children's emotional well-being and offers insights and strategies for healing and growth.

In addition to Adult Children of Emotionally Immature Parents, Gibson has authored other works related to psychological topics and emotional growth, including Recovering from Emotionally Immature Parents (released in 2021), which serves as a guide for those looking to heal from the effects of having emotionally immature parents.

Here are five compelling books that delve into themes of emotional growth, personal development, and understanding family dynamics. These recommendations will resonate with anyone seeking insight into their own upbringing or looking to navigate their emotional lives more effectively.

  1. "The Body Keeps the Score" by Bessel van der Kolk

This groundbreaking book explores the impact of trauma on the body and mind. Van der Kolk, a renowned psychiatrist, shares research and compelling stories that demonstrate how trauma is stored in the body and influences our emotional and physical health. It offers valuable insights into healing, mindfulness, and advanced therapeutic approaches.

  1. "Healing the Child Within" by Charles L. Whitfield

In this classic self-help book, Whitfield emphasizes the significance of understanding and nurturing the inner child we all carry. He provides insights into the effects of childhood experiences on adult behavior and relationships. Through practical exercises and reflections, readers can learn to heal past wounds and develop healthier emotional patterns.

  1. "Adult Children: The Secrets of Dysfunctional Families" by James W. F. McGowan

This book discusses the common characteristics of adult children from dysfunctional families. McGowan sheds light on the dynamics that shape adult behaviors, offering readers strategies to break free from ingrained patterns. The book encourages self-awareness and emotional resilience, making it an invaluable resource for anyone navigating family issues.

  1. "Daring Greatly" by Brené Brown

In "Daring Greatly," Brené Brown explores the power of vulnerability and how it can lead to a more fulfilling life. She uncovers myths about vulnerability and discusses the importance of connection, courage, and authenticity. This book is impactful for anyone looking to embrace their emotions and transform their relationships.

  1. "The Drama of the Gifted Child" by Alice Miller

Miller’s classic work investigates the complexities of childhood development, particularly for gifted children who may struggle with emotional authenticity due to parental expectations. The book highlights the importance of acknowledging and nurturing one’s true self, making it a profound read for anyone seeking to understand the balance between parental influence and personal identity.
